    Type-I superconductivity in YbSb2 single crystals
    (American Physical Society, 2012) Zhao, Liang L.; Lausberg, Stefan; Kim, H.; Tanatar, M.A.; Brando, Manuel; Prozorov, R.; Morosan, E.
    We present evidence of type-I superconductivity in YbSb2 single crystals from dc and ac magnetization, heat capacity, and resistivity measurements. The critical temperature and critical field are determined to be Tc ≈ 1.3 K and Hc ≈ 55 Oe. A small Ginzburg-Landau parameter κ = 0.05, together with typical magnetization isotherms of type-I superconductors, small critical field values, a strong differential paramagnetic effect signal, and a fieldinduced change from second- to first-order phase transition, confirms the type-I nature of the superconductivity in YbSb2. A possible second superconducting state is observed in the radio-frequency susceptibility measurements, with T (2) c ≈ 0.41 K and H(2) c ≈ 430 Oe.
